Image

Reidrubber - Products, promotion, and factory buildings

Date: [ca 1938]-1978

From: Beverley Reid and Josephine Towsey :Photographs relating to Reid NZ Rubber Mills Ltd

Reference: PAColl-9425-3

Description: Products include among other things - Tyres. Plugs. Mats and floor coverings. Tubing. Reidoprene urethane foam sheets. tap washers. Balls. Plungers. Stick on shoe soles. Seat buffers. Mallets. Hot water bottles. Reidrubber buffers installed in the Devonport ferry wharf, October 1956. Promotions include - Exhibitions of products at trade fairs from ca 1938 to 1959. The Reid New Zealand Rubber Mills Ltd's stand at the New Zealand Centennial Exhibition, Rongatai, Wellington, 1939-1940. An ambulance equipped with Reidrubber tyres. A truck loaded with tyres. A van advertising Reidrubber tyres. View of factory buildings include - The first part of the Ellerslie factory built in 1945 to the designs of architect Horace Massey. Aerial views of the factory from 1951 to 1962. Aerial view of an Auckland street (possibly Stanley Street) showing among other things, the building occupied by Ridge Tyre Remoulding Co Ltd., 19 March 1963. Aerial view of Reid Rubber Ltd and Hercules Handles Ltd, Penrose Road, Penrose, March 1957. Two photographs of Reidrubber and Feltex engineering staff, August 1978. Quantity: 72 b&w original photographic print(s). 2 colour original photographic print(s).

Image

Export award and trade displays of refrigerators

Date: [ca 1955-1975]

From: Institute of Refrigeration, Heating & Air Conditioning Engineers of New Zealand Inc (IRHACE) :Photographs

Reference: PAColl-10012-1

Description: Many of these photographs relate to the products of McAlpine Refrigeration Ltd. The collection includes - Large electrical units in a factory yard or on a wharf. A National Distributors Convention, April 1956, held in conjunction with a trade fair in which McAlpine, and Prestcold products manufactured by Pressed Steel Co Ltd are conspicuous. Presentation of an export award in the form of a pennant and citation, to McAlpine Refrigeration Ltd for "outstanding contribution to New Zealand trade" 1973. Includes people looking at examples of McAlpine and Prestcold products. Refrigeration technology by McAlpine Refrigeration (North Shore) Ltd. Interiors of two bars and a large factory cafeteria, ca 1950s. Trade displays by McAlpine Refrigeration Ltd of domestic and commercial refrigerators by McAlpine and Prestcold. Portraits of "Perfection" washing machines. Refrigerated van for delivering "Peach" bacon, ham, and sausages. Photographs of commercial display refrigerators in shops. Two large ice bank tanks on the road to New Plymouth bound for Iraq, ca 1970s. BP Petrochemical products at a trade fair. Views of an unidentified factory interior. Loaded trucks in the yard of a McAlpine factory, 1970s. Arrangement: This group of photographs were originally in an album entitled "Electrical & Appliance Servicing Federation of New Zealand (Inc)." They were removed because the plastic enclosures in the album were degrading. Quantity: 76 b&w original photographic print(s). 1 colour original photographic print(s). Physical Description: Photographic prints
